1.背景介绍
人工智能(AI)已经成为现代科技的重要驱动力,它正在改变我们的生活方式、工作方式和社会结构。随着AI技术的不断发展,人类道德问题也逐渐成为了关注的焦点。人类道德是一种对行为和决策的道德判断,它是人类社会的基本规则和价值观的体现。然而,随着AI技术的发展,人类道德和AI的道德判断也面临着挑战。
在这篇文章中,我们将探讨人类道德与AI的共同挑战,以及如何应对道德判断的变革。我们将从以下几个方面进行讨论:
- 背景介绍
- 核心概念与联系
- 核心算法原理和具体操作步骤以及数学模型公式详细讲解
- 具体代码实例和详细解释说明
- 未来发展趋势与挑战
- 附录常见问题与解答
1.背景介绍
人类道德的起源可以追溯到古典哲学家的思考,如埃斯克里特(Aristotle)和儒家思想。人类道德是一种对行为和决策的道德判断,它是人类社会的基本规则和价值观的体现。随着人类社会的发展,道德观念也不断演进,从个体道德到社会道德,再到全球道德。
随着AI技术的发展,人类道德问题也逐渐成为了关注的焦点。AI技术已经广泛应用于医疗、金融、交通等各个领域,它已经成为了人类生活中不可或缺的一部分。然而,随着AI技术的不断发展,人类道德和AI的道德判断也面临着挑战。
2.核心概念与联系
在探讨人类道德与AI的共同挑战时,我们需要明确以下几个核心概念:
- 道德判断:道德判断是一种对行为和决策的道德评价,它是人类社会的基本规则和价值观的体现。
- 人类道德:人类道德是一种对行为和决策的道德判断,它是人类社会的基本规则和价值观的体现。
- AI道德:AI道德是一种对AI系统的道德判断,它是AI系统的行为和决策的道德评价。
这些概念之间的联系如下:
- 人类道德与AI道德的联系:AI技术的发展使得人类道德和AI道德之间存在着紧密的联系。AI系统的行为和决策需要遵循人类道德的基本规则和价值观,以确保其行为是道德可接受的。
- 人类道德与AI道德的差异:尽管人类道德和AI道德之间存在紧密的联系,但它们之间也存在一定的差异。AI道德需要考虑到AI系统的特点,如无感知、无情感、无自我意识等特点。这些特点使得AI道德的判断与人类道德的判断存在一定的差异。
3.核心算法原理和具体操作步骤以及数学模型公式详细讲解
在应对人类道德与AI的共同挑战时,我们需要关注以下几个核心算法原理:
- 道德判断算法:道德判断算法是一种用于对AI系统行为和决策进行道德判断的算法。它需要考虑到人类道德的基本规则和价值观,以确保其判断是道德可接受的。
- 道德学习算法:道德学习算法是一种用于让AI系统学习人类道德的算法。它需要考虑到AI系统的学习能力和适应性,以确保其学习到的道德规则和价值观是正确的。
- 道德控制算法:道德控制算法是一种用于控制AI系统行为和决策的算法。它需要考虑到AI系统的控制能力和可靠性,以确保其行为是道德可接受的。
以下是具体操作步骤和数学模型公式详细讲解:
- 道德判断算法
道德判断算法的核心思想是将人类道德的基本规则和价值观编码为数学模型,然后使用这个模型来评估AI系统的行为和决策是否符合道德规则。具体操作步骤如下:
- 首先,需要将人类道德的基本规则和价值观编码为数学模型。这可以通过逻辑规则、约束条件、目标函数等方式来实现。
- 然后,需要使用这个数学模型来评估AI系统的行为和决策是否符合道德规则。这可以通过比较AI系统的行为和决策与数学模型所描述的道德规则来实现。
数学模型公式为:
其中, 表示AI系统的行为和决策是否符合道德规则, 表示AI系统的行为和决策, 表示道德阈值。
- 道德学习算法
道德学习算法的核心思想是让AI系统通过学习人类道德的基本规则和价值观,从而能够更好地遵循人类道德。具体操作步骤如下:
- 首先,需要将人类道德的基本规则和价值观编码为数学模型。这可以通过逻辑规则、约束条件、目标函数等方式来实现。
- 然后,需要让AI系统通过学习这个数学模型,从而能够更好地遵循人类道德。这可以通过使用机器学习、深度学习等技术来实现。
数学模型公式为:
其中, 表示损失函数, 表示模型参数, 表示AI系统的行为和决策, 表示人类道德的基本规则和价值观, 表示损失函数, 表示正则化项, 表示正则化参数。
- 道德控制算法
道德控制算法的核心思想是通过控制AI系统的行为和决策,确保其符合人类道德规则。具体操作步骤如下:
- 首先,需要将人类道德的基本规则和价值观编码为数学模型。这可以通过逻辑规则、约束条件、目标函数等方式来实现。
- 然后,需要使用这个数学模型来控制AI系统的行为和决策。这可以通过使用约束优化、违反检测等技术来实现。
数学模型公式为:
其中, 表示AI系统的行为和决策是否符合道德规则, 表示AI系统的行为和决策, 表示道德阈值。
4.具体代码实例和详细解释说明
在本节中,我们将通过一个具体的代码实例来说明上述算法原理的实现。我们将使用Python编程语言和Scikit-learn库来实现道德判断算法、道德学习算法和道德控制算法。
4.1 道德判断算法实现
import numpy as np
from sklearn.linear_model import LogisticRegression
# 人类道德规则
rules = [
{'attribute': 'age', 'value': 18, 'op': '>='},
{'attribute': 'alcohol', 'value': 0.6, 'op': '<='},
]
# 数据集
data = np.array([
[20, 0.5],
[18, 0.6],
[20, 0.7],
[18, 0.6],
])
# 编码人类道德规则
def encode_rules(rules):
f = np.vectorize(lambda x, op: op(x) if op in ['>=', '<='] else 1 - op(x))
return np.apply_along_axis(f, 1, data, **rules)
# 道德判断
def ethical_judgment(x):
f = encode_rules(rules)
return np.all(f >= 1)
# 训练模型
model = LogisticRegression()
model.fit(data, ethical_judgment(data))
# 预测
x = np.array([[20, 0.5], [18, 0.6], [20, 0.7], [18, 0.6]])
y_pred = model.predict(x)
print(y_pred)
4.2 道德学习算法实现
from sklearn.datasets import make_classification
from sklearn.model_selection import train_test_split
from sklearn.linear_model import LogisticRegression
from sklearn.preprocessing import StandardScaler
# 生成数据集
X, y = make_classification(n_samples=1000, n_features=20, n_informative=10, n_redundant=10, random_state=42)
X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.2, random_state=42)
# 标准化
scaler = StandardScaler()
X_train = scaler.fit_transform(X_train)
X_test = scaler.transform(X_test)
# 道德学习
def ethical_learning(X_train, y_train, X_test, y_test):
model = LogisticRegression()
model.fit(X_train, y_train)
y_pred = model.predict(X_test)
return model, y_pred
model, y_pred = ethical_learning(X_train, y_train, X_test, y_test)
print(y_pred)
4.3 道德控制算法实现
from sklearn.preprocessing import MinMaxScaler
# 道德控制
def ethical_control(X, rules):
f = encode_rules(rules)
scaler = MinMaxScaler(feature_range=(-1, 1))
X_control = scaler.fit_transform(X)
X_control = np.hstack((np.ones((X_control.shape[0], 1)), X_control))
return np.minimum(np.maximum(X_control, -1), 1)
# 测试数据
X_test = np.array([[20, 0.5], [18, 0.6], [20, 0.7], [18, 0.6]])
rules = [
{'attribute': 'age', 'value': 18, 'op': '>='},
{'attribute': 'alcohol', 'value': 0.6, 'op': '<='},
]
X_test_control = ethical_control(X_test, rules)
print(X_test_control)
5.未来发展趋势与挑战
随着AI技术的不断发展,人类道德与AI的共同挑战将会面临着新的挑战。未来的发展趋势与挑战如下:
- AI技术的发展:随着AI技术的发展,人类道德与AI的共同挑战将会更加复杂。例如,随着自主化AI技术的发展,人类道德与AI的共同挑战将会涉及到AI系统的自主决策和责任问题。
- AI应用领域的拓展:随着AI技术的应用范围的拓展,人类道德与AI的共同挑战将会涉及到更多领域。例如,随着AI医疗技术的发展,人类道德与AI的共同挑战将会涉及到医疗道德问题。
- AI技术的可解释性:随着AI技术的发展,AI系统的决策过程的可解释性将会成为人类道德与AI的共同挑战之一。例如,随着深度学习技术的发展,AI系统的决策过程变得更加复杂,从而导致AI系统的可解释性问题。
- AI技术的道德框架:随着AI技术的发展,人类道德与AI的共同挑战将会涉及到AI技术的道德框架问题。例如,随着AI技术的发展,人类道德的基本规则和价值观将会面临挑战,从而导致AI技术的道德框架问题。
6.附录常见问题与解答
在本节中,我们将解答一些常见问题,以帮助读者更好地理解人类道德与AI的共同挑战。
6.1 道德判断与AI技术的关系
道德判断与AI技术的关系是人类道德与AI的共同挑战的核心问题。道德判断是一种对行为和决策的道德评价,它是人类社会的基本规则和价值观的体现。随着AI技术的发展,人类道德与AI的共同挑战将会更加复杂。AI技术需要遵循人类道德的基本规则和价值观,以确保其行为是道德可接受的。
6.2 AI技术的道德框架
AI技术的道德框架是人类道德与AI的共同挑战的一个方面。AI技术的道德框架需要考虑到AI系统的特点,如无感知、无情感、无自我意识等特点。这些特点使得AI技术的道德框架的判断与人类道德的判断存在一定的差异。因此,在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德框架问题。
6.3 AI技术的可解释性
AI技术的可解释性是人类道德与AI的共同挑战之一。随着AI技术的发展,AI系统的决策过程变得更加复杂,从而导致AI系统的可解释性问题。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的可解释性问题,以确保AI系统的决策是道德可接受的。
6.4 AI技术的道德学习
AI技术的道德学习是人类道德与AI的共同挑战的一个方面。AI技术需要学习人类道德的基本规则和价值观,以确保其行为是道德可接受的。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习问题,以确保AI系统能够学习到正确的道德规则和价值观。
6.5 AI技术的道德控制
AI技术的道德控制是人类道德与AI的共同挑战的一个方面。AI技术需要通过控制其行为和决策,确保其符合人类道德规则。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德控制问题,以确保AI系统的行为是道德可接受的。
6.6 AI技术的道德判断
AI技术的道德判断是人类道德与AI的共同挑战的一个方面。AI技术需要对其行为和决策进行道德判断,以确保其符合人类道德规则。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德判断问题,以确保AI系统的行为是道德可接受的。
6.7 AI技术的道德学习与道德判断的关系
AI技术的道德学习与道德判断之间存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,而道德判断是AI技术对其行为和决策是否符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习与道德判断之间的关系,以确保AI系统能够学习到正确的道德规则和价值观,并能够对其行为和决策进行正确的道德判断。
6.8 AI技术的道德控制与道德判断的关系
AI技术的道德控制与道德判断之间也存在密切的关系。道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则的过程,而道德判断是AI技术对其行为和决策是否符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德控制与道德判断之间的关系,以确保AI系统能够通过控制其行为和决策来符合人类道德规则。
6.9 AI技术的道德学习与道德控制的关系
AI技术的道德学习与道德控制之间也存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,而道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习与道德控制之间的关系,以确保AI系统能够学习到正确的道德规则和价值观,并能够通过控制其行为和决策来符合人类道德规则。
6.10 AI技术的道德学习与道德判断与道德控制的关系
AI技术的道德学习、道德判断与道德控制之间存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,道德判断是AI技术对其行为和决策是否符合人类道德规则的过程,道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习、道德判断与道德控制之间的关系,以确保AI系统能够学习到正确的道德规则和价值观,并能够对其行为和决策进行正确的道德判断,同时能够通过控制其行为和决策来符合人类道德规则。
6.11 AI技术的道德学习与道德控制与道德判断的关系
AI技术的道德学习、道德控制与道德判断之间存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则的过程,道德判断是AI技术对其行为和决策是否符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习、道德控制与道德判断之间的关系,以确保AI系统能够学习到正确的道德规则和价值观,并能够通过控制其行为和决策来符合人类道德规则,同时能够对其行为和决策进行正确的道德判断。
6.12 AI技术的道德学习与道德判断与道德控制的关系
AI技术的道德学习、道德判断与道德控制之间存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,道德判断是AI技术对其行为和决策是否符合人类道德规则的过程,道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习、道德判断与道德控制之间的关系,以确保AI系统能够学习到正确的道德规则和价值观,并能够对其行为和决策进行正确的道德判断,同时能够通过控制其行为和决策来符合人类道德规则。
6.13 AI技术的道德学习与道德控制与道德判断的关系
AI技术的道德学习、道德控制与道德判断之间存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则的过程,道德判断是AI技术对其行为和决策是否符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习、道德控制与道德判断之间的关系,以确保AI系统能够学习到正确的道德规则和价值观,并能够通过控制其行为和决策来符合人类道德规则,同时能够对其行为和决策进行正确的道德判断。
6.14 AI技术的道德学习与道德判断与道德控制的关系
AI技术的道德学习、道德判断与道德控制之间存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,道德判断是AI技术对其行为和决策是否符合人类道德规则的过程,道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习、道德判断与道德控制之间的关系,以确保AI系统能够学习到正确的道德规则和价值观,并能够对其行为和决策进行正确的道德判断,同时能够通过控制其行为和决策来符合人类道德规则。
6.15 AI技术的道德学习与道德判断与道德控制的关系
AI技术的道德学习、道德判断与道德控制之间存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,道德判断是AI技术对其行为和决策是否符合人类道德规则的过程,道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习、道德判断与道德控制之间的关系,以确保AI系统能够学习到正确的道德规则和价值观,并能够对其行为和决策进行正确的道德判断,同时能够通过控制其行为和决策来符合人类道德规则。
6.16 AI技术的道德学习与道德判断与道德控制的关系
AI技术的道德学习、道德判断与道德控制之间存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,道德判断是AI技术对其行为和决策是否符合人类道德规则的过程,道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习、道德判断与道德控制之间的关系,以确保AI系统能够学习到正确的道德规则和价值观,并能够对其行为和决策进行正确的道德判断,同时能够通过控制其行为和决策来符合人类道德规则。
6.17 AI技术的道德学习与道德判断与道德控制的关系
AI技术的道德学习、道德判断与道德控制之间存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,道德判断是AI技术对其行为和决策是否符合人类道德规则的过程,道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习、道德判断与道德控制之间的关系,以确保AI系统能够学习到正确的道德规则和价值观,并能够对其行为和决策进行正确的道德判断,同时能够通过控制其行为和决策来符合人类道德规则。
6.18 AI技术的道德学习与道德判断与道德控制的关系
AI技术的道德学习、道德判断与道德控制之间存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,道德判断是AI技术对其行为和决策是否符合人类道德规则的过程,道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则的过程。在应对人类道德与AI的共同挑战时,我们需要关注AI技术的道德学习、道德判断与道德控制之间的关系,以确保AI系统能够学习到正确的道德规则和价值观,并能够对其行为和决策进行正确的道德判断,同时能够通过控制其行为和决策来符合人类道德规则。
6.19 AI技术的道德学习与道德判断与道德控制的关系
AI技术的道德学习、道德判断与道德控制之间存在密切的关系。道德学习是AI技术学习人类道德规则和价值观的过程,道德判断是AI技术对其行为和决策是否符合人类道德规则的过程,道德控制是AI技术通过控制其行为和决策来确保其符合人类道德规则